Orodha ya maudhui:

Mchezaji wa piano: Hatua 10 (na Picha)
Mchezaji wa piano: Hatua 10 (na Picha)

Video: Mchezaji wa piano: Hatua 10 (na Picha)

Video: Mchezaji wa piano: Hatua 10 (na Picha)
Video: AMENIWEKA HURU KWELI(SkizaCode 6930218)- PAPI CLEVER & DORCAS Ft MERCI PIANIST : MORNING WORSHIP 146 2024, Julai
Anonim
Image
Image
Ugonjwa wa De Corredera
Ugonjwa wa De Corredera

El objetivo del proyecto es elaborar un sistema que pueda tocar música preprogramada en las teclas digitales de una aplicación de piano para el iPad 2.

Mfumo wa uundaji wa mpango wa unistro de un libra de libertad de desplazamiento lineal actuado por un sistema banda polea acoplado un motor de pasos for mover una base rectangular en la que se encuentran tres servomotores que fungen como dedos del sistema para to car la canción

Hatua ya 1: Materiales

Arduino UNO

Dereva A4988

Magari ya kukanyaga NEMA17

3 x Micro Servo sg90

'Dedos touch' hechos de acrílico y adjuntos con aluminio

Fuente 12V

Fuente 5V

Cobre ya kebo

Vipengee vya alumini t20 2 x 40 cm

Varillas de 8 mm x 40 cm

Polea y banda GT2

Placas de acrílico de 6 mm

Tornillos

Hatua ya 2: Diseño De Corredera

Ugonjwa wa De Corredera
Ugonjwa wa De Corredera

El sistema del carro es básicamente una corredera con unas guías lineales soportadas por unas paredes de acrílico (piezas) na unas barras de sujeción

Para esta parte se utilizaron perfiles de aluminio t20, piezas de acrílico de 6mm para las paredes y varillas de 8mm de diámetro que funcionan como las guías para el carro.

La estructura de la figura ni kama somo la kati la mipira ya de pulgada na 1 pulgada de largo en la parte de los perfiles extruidos. Por otra parte, los tornillos que presionan las barras son también de 1/4, pero estos son más cortos, pul de pulgada de largo para hacer presión.

Hatua ya 3: Diseño Del Carro

Ugonjwa wa Del Carro
Ugonjwa wa Del Carro

Los sliders de nylamid se perforan para encajar en la guía de 8mm de diámetro

Hatua ya 4: Montaje Del Stepper Motor Y Polea

Montaje Del Stepper Motor Y Polea
Montaje Del Stepper Motor Y Polea
Montaje Del Stepper Motor Y Polea
Montaje Del Stepper Motor Y Polea

El motor de pasos Nema 17 se encuentra montado mediante tres tornillos m4 x 12 mm que van desde la pared lateral de acrílico hasta el soporte del motor, vifaa vya magari vinavyowezeshwa na msingi wa sarakasi (Base_Stepper) na kituo cha M3 x 10mm. Umalizio, ingiza na kuingiza GT2 kwenye la flecha del stepper

Del otro lado se monta un balero que es la contraparte de la polea GT2. Je! Unapenda kituo hiki? Hebu tujue katika maoni hapa chini:)

Hatua ya 5: Diseño De La Mano

Ugonjwa wa De La Mano
Ugonjwa wa De La Mano
Ugonjwa wa De La Mano
Ugonjwa wa De La Mano

El diseño mecánico de la mano se conforma del ensamble de dos placas rectangulares de acrílico unidas por cuatro soportes de madera mdf de 6 mm, otros dos soportes de madera se encuentran extra entre las placas for sujetar la banda dentada que hará el desplazamiento lineal eje X.

Sobre la placa bora hay tres orificios rectangulares sobre los que se han ajustados tres servomotores. a las flechas de éstos se ha ajustado un 'dedo' de acrílico, donde el dedo del servomotor de en medio es recto, y los de los extremos tienen una inclinación de 25º para el centro, ésto para qué la punta de los tres dedos tengan una separación de 17 mm entre cada uno, para poder posicionar cada punta en tres teclas blancas consecutivas.

Hatua ya 6: Ensamble

Ensamble
Ensamble

Sherehe ya ujenzi wa sarafu ya gari na gari inayopatikana mnamo mwezi wa banda la dentada de la polea ya GT2 na elimu ya msingi kwa ajili ya mwisho wa mwisho wa kufuata kanuni ya picha.

Hatua ya 7: Conexion Del Motor Pasos

Conexion Del Motor ni Pasos
Conexion Del Motor ni Pasos

El motor de pasos Nema 17 está alimentado por una fuente de 12V y conectado al Arduino UNO través de un driver A4988 y un CNC Shield para Arduino para el control del mismo. Aquí se muestra el esquemático de las conexiones

Hatua ya 8: Conexión De Los Microservos

Conexión De Los Microservos
Conexión De Los Microservos

Es necesaria una fuente independiente de 5V, la señal de los servos van a los pines del arduino que estén libres, como ejemplo, 5, 6, 7 (pueden variar). La señal de los servos son conectados a los pines, con su voltajes y tierras puenteados respectivamente

Hatua ya 9: Sistema Touch Para Los "dedos"

Sistema Kugusa Para Los
Sistema Kugusa Para Los

se recomienda hacerlos con elementos planos en los extremos. Envueltos en aluminio, cuidando que quede lo más plano posible, conectados a cables con una carga de 5V of que estamos utilizando un iPad como piano. Si se utiliza un piano físico este paso no es necesario

Hatua ya 10: Programación

Programu
Programu
Programu
Programu

La idea principal de la programación es hacer cuatro arrays para cada canción; los cuales deben ser del mismo tamaño. La programación contiene todas las canciones programadas dentro de un switch; para escoger la cancaón tocar el usuario manda por comunicación serial el nombre de la canción que desea.

Mkutano wa kwanza wa maoni juu ya maoni ya watu kwa njia ya habari. Katika programu hii, usanidi wa A, B, C na D unakaribisha mita 3 kwa mara tatu, kwa sababu hiyo ni jumla ya vipindi 12 vya notisi. Dhambi za watu wengine hutengeneza piano kwa alcanzar otras notas dependiendo de la canción que se tocara y las notas que esta necesite.

Jumuiya 3 inajumuisha mambo mawili, ambayo inataja hali ya kuwa na ruhusa ya kutoa huduma kwa wahusika (tocando la tecla). Este array como los demás debe tener el mismo tamaño ya que cada elemento corresponde a cada nota, kwa mfano wa taarifa 1 ya uwanja wa B, kati ya 3 na una duración de 300 ms.

Jumuiya ya 4 ya kuchelewesha kucheleweshwa kwa teclas, ndio maana wanatafuta shughuli zaidi ya moja kwa moja, kwa hivyo watafanya kazi ya kupitisha dhambi kwa sababu ya huduma ya serikali.

Ilipendekeza: